Calpine and its consolidated subsidiaries are engaged in the business of generating and selling of electricity and electricity-related products, through the operation of its portfolio of power generation facilities. Co. markets electricity produced by its generating facilities to utilities and other third party purchasers while thermal energy produced by the gas-fired power cogeneration facilities is primarily sold to industrial users. As of Dec 31 2007, Co.'s portfolio of plants was comprised of two power generation technologies: natural gas-fired combustion (primarily combined-cycle) and renewable geothermal facilities.
